Jacob Malkoun enters as the consensus favorite in this middleweight main card clash at UFC Perth on May 2, driven by his two-fight win streak, including unanimous decisions over Andre Petroski and Torrez Finney, showcasing elite wrestling and defensive grappling that neutralizes submission threats. Gerald Meerschaert, a 38-year-old submission specialist with 37 career wins mostly by choke, arrives on a four-fight skid and missed weight at 190 pounds yesterday—five over the limit—forfeiting 30% of his purse, though the bout proceeds at RAC Arena. Traders weigh Malkoun's youth, momentum, and home-crowd edge in Australia against Meerschaert's guillotine danger if he survives early takedowns, with no reported injuries altering lineups.
